Italy: G20 health ministers make "pact" for global access to COVID vaccines

Italian Minister of Health Roberto Speranza gave a final press conference following the G20 Health Ministers’ Meeting in Rome on Monday, September 6.

“There is a political commitment to distribute vaccines to the whole world,” Speranza said, adding that the 20 richest countries in the world agreed on the ‘pact of Rome’ to make healthcare a human right and to distribute COVID vaccines to the whole world.

The meeting took place under the Italian Presidency of the G20 for two days (September 5-6) and aimed at taking the lead in ensuring a swift international response to the COVID-19 pandemic worldwide while building up resilience to future health-related shocks.
